Rye IPA (10 gal)

All Grain Recipe

Submitted By: PointBreezeBrewing (Shared)
Members can download and share recipes

Batch Size: 11.00 galStyle: American IPA (14B)
Boil Size: 14.48 galStyle Guide: BJCP 2008
Color: 13.4 SRMEquipment: Stainless Kegs (10 Gal/37.8 L) - All Grain
Bitterness: 67.1 IBUsBoil Time: 60 min
Est OG: 1.063 (15.3° P)Mash Profile: Single Infusion, Medium Body, No Mash Out
Est FG: 1.014 SG (3.5° P)Fermentation: Ale, Two Stage
ABV: 6.5%Taste Rating: 30.0

Ingredients
Amount Name Type #
17 lbs 8.00 oz Pale Malt (2 Row) US (2.0 SRM) Grain 1
6 lbs Caramel/Crystal Malt - 40L (40.0 SRM) Grain 2
4 lbs Rye Malt (4.7 SRM) Grain 3
2.50 oz Simcoe [13.0%] - Boil 60 min Hops 4
1.00 oz Amarillo [9.2%] - Boil 30 min Hops 5
2.00 oz Amarillo [9.2%] - Boil 5 min Hops 6
1.00 oz Simcoe [13.0%] - Boil 0 min Hops 7
1.0 pkgs California Ale (White Labs #WLP001) Yeast 8
2.00 oz Amarillo [9.2%] - Dry Hop 14 days Hops 9
